And when I say She, I mean, the actress that is the reason this show even opened on Broadway in the first place.

Not too long after the critics drooled all over Nina Arianda’s performance in last year’s Born Yesterday, a revival of David Ives’ Venus In Fur was slated for The Great White Way this fall.  With similar praise showered upon Ms. Arianda and the production, the limited run soon turned into an extension, that include an expensive move to another theater.
